Chicago's Best Mexican Food
Expertly blending traditional Mexico with creative interpretations of local and seasonal ingredients is the inspiration behind Mercadito restaurants.
Spanish for 'little market' Mercadito is modeled after the markets chef Patricio Sandoval shopped at while growing up in his native Mexico. His muse is the cuisine of the southern region but when mixed with his own style he creates authentic dishes with an added flair.
